ts Problem 3-Activity-based costing: factory overhead costs The total factory overhead for Bardot Marine Company is budgeted for the year at $1,152,150, divided into four activities: fabrication, $638,000; assembly, $243,000; setup, $147,900; and inspection, $123,250. Bardot Marine manufactures two types of boats: speedboats and bass boats. The activity-base usage quantities for each product by each activity are as follows: Product Fabrication Assembly Setup Inspection er Hub Speedboat 7,250 dlh 20,250 dlh 52 91 setups inspections Bass boat 21,750 dlh 6,750 dlh 383 634 setups inspections Total 29,000 dlh 27,000 dlh 435 725 setups inspections Each product is budgeted for 4,500 units of production for the year. Determine (A) the activity rates for each activity and (B) the activity-based factory overhead per unit for each product. Round to the nearest $.
